    Hi,
    first of all I want to thank you for this great plugin and making it available for free – really great work and I highly appreciate it!

    I recently installed SlimStat (Version 3.6.1) and my page load times rose up from <2 seconds to >10 seconds
    Of course I do not want my users to have a performance like this so I am asking myself what could cause this issue?

    as I said, i installed SlimStat the first time so my DB is of initial size
    I tried both, JavaScript and Server Side tracking – both have the same issue

    could it be an resource issue on my server – I am on a shared environment
    however a decrease of page load time by a factor of >5 still seems very odd to me

    any ideas on this?

    nybello

    (@nybello)

    I disabled CDN and UAN (Settings -> Advanced tab) and my site site response is fast again.

    Thread Starter gbrueckl

    (@gbrueckl)

    UAN seems to cause the issue for me
    CDN has like no impact

    disabled UAN and my responsetimes are normal again!
